Lake won the last time they faced Scott Central and things went their way on Friday too. The Hornets put the hurt on the Rebels with a sharp 16-2 win. The result was nothing new for the Hornets, who have now won 16 matches by ten runs or more so far this season.

Wes Nester made a splash no matter where he played. He pitched four innings while giving up just two earned runs off three hits. Nester was also solid in the batter's box, going 2-for-3 with one stolen base and one double.

In other batting news, Lake got a massive performance out of Trey Gray, who scored four runs and stole four bases while getting on base in all four of his plate appearances. That's the most stolen bases Gray has posted since back in March. Aidan Dilley also deserves some recognition as he launched his first home run of the season.

Lake always had someone on base and finished the game having posted an OBP of .581. They easily outclassed their opponents in that department as Scott Central only posted an OBP of .312.

The victory made it two in a row for Lake and bumps their season record up to 19-4. Those wins came thanks in part to their pitching effort, having only surrendered a grand total of 3 runs in those games. As for Scott Central, their loss dropped their record down to 4-17.

Lake wasted no time getting back out on the field and has already played their next game, a 14-4 victory against Union on the 5th. As for Scott Central, they have also already played their next contest, a 10-6 defeat against Raleigh on the 5th.
